Check 'Element's representation in Sprint 2.3' with uuid=23b70110-014e-4a7d-c0de-1fc10ce1deb1
There were 1 applicable and 0 not applicable IfcUndergroundExcavation(s) in the checked file.
2.3.2.ii) Correct Representation for Element: correct surfaic or volumentric type used. Following may be used: Body tesselation, Body Brep, Body Swept Solid, Surface Model, Voxel, Surface Tesselation
The following instances are failing:
352, with GlobalId '3rVsqBF4j7UvaqqoBZaBIg'
In sprint 2.3 the allowed geometries does not allow Body Sectioned SolidHorizontal.
However in Sprint3.exc 1.i.a one of the allowed geometries is Body Sectioned SolidHorizontal
The current checker is complaining when I use Body Sectioned SolidHorizontal in Sprint 3.exc (RepresentationType = AdvancedSweptSolid).
The error message indicate it is due to the Sprint 2.3 limitation?
